What is a Non-Motorised Treadmill?
A non-motorised treadmill is a self-propelled exercise machine that allows users to stroll, jog, or run without depending on an electric motor. Instead, the user produces the movement, which engages more muscle groups and promotes a more natural running kind. These treadmills come in different styles and are frequently lighter and more portable than their motorised equivalents.
Benefits of Non-Motorised Treadmills1. Effectiveness in Workouts
Engaging more muscle groups than standard treadmills, users can attain reliable workouts in a shorter span. The self-propelling function means that the pace is determined by the user, permitting much better control of strength.
2. Economical
Typically cheaper than motorised treadmills, non-motorised variations have less parts that can break down, resulting in lower maintenance expenses.
3. Space-Saving Design
Many non-motorised treadmills are compact and can easily suit smaller areas, making them a perfect option for home gyms.
4. Flexibility
These treadmills can be used for various exercises, including walking, running, and even higher-intensity period training (HIIT). The adjustable nature of the speed means users can quickly switch between various types of training.
5. Security
Without electrical components, non-motorised treadmills provide a lower danger of electrical risks, and their simplicity frequently leads to a lower danger of mechanical failures.
